The invention discloses a method for synchronously extracting proanthocyanidin and selenium-enriched protein from black peanut skin. Firstly, the black peanut skin subjected to liquid nitrogen freezing superfine grinding, then ultrasonic-assisted extraction of the proanthocyanidin and ultrasonic-assisted extraction of the selenium-enriched protein are performed simultaneously, prepared proanthocyanidin powder is high in proanthocyanidin content and high in activity, and the selenium-enriched protein is high in organic selenium content and high in activity. With the adoption of the method for preparing two active substances (the proanthocyanidin and the selenium-enriched protein) from the raw material, namely, the black peanut skin, the technological process can be simplified, the raw material cost can be reduced, the working efficiency can be improved, in addition, the method is high in extraction rate and suitable for industrial production, and the activity of extracted substances is high.
